Fidei Architecture Salary

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Fidei Architecture in the United States is $86,124.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$41. Salaries at Fidei Architecture typically range from $75,691 to $97,429 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Akron?

Understanding the cost of living near Akron is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Fidei Architecture.
Akron's Cost of Living Index is approximately 76.8 (23.2% less expensive than US average; 15.4% less than OH average). NE OH city, 'Rubber Capital', very affordable. METRO RTA. When planning your budget based on a salary from Fidei Architecture, consider these typical monthly expenses:
